Advanced Micro Devices (AMD) Non-Current Deferred Tax Liability (2021 - 2025)

Advanced Micro Devices (AMD) has disclosed Non-Current Deferred Tax Liability for 7 consecutive years, with $4.1 billion as the latest value for Q4 2025.

  • Quarterly Non-Current Deferred Tax Liability rose 1070.2% to $4.1 billion in Q4 2025 from the year-ago period, while the trailing twelve-month figure was $4.1 billion through Dec 2025, up 1070.2% year-over-year, with the annual reading at $4.1 billion for FY2025, 1070.2% up from the prior year.
  • Non-Current Deferred Tax Liability hit $4.1 billion in Q4 2025 for Advanced Micro Devices, up from $326.0 million in the prior quarter.
  • In the past five years, Non-Current Deferred Tax Liability ranged from a high of $4.1 billion in Q4 2025 to a low of $12.0 million in Q4 2021.
  • Historically, Non-Current Deferred Tax Liability has averaged $1.6 billion across 5 years, with a median of $1.2 billion in 2024.
  • Biggest five-year swings in Non-Current Deferred Tax Liability: soared 16016.67% in 2022 and later plummeted 91.14% in 2024.
  • Year by year, Non-Current Deferred Tax Liability stood at $12.0 million in 2021, then skyrocketed by 16016.67% to $1.9 billion in 2022, then soared by 103.62% to $3.9 billion in 2023, then tumbled by 91.14% to $349.0 million in 2024, then skyrocketed by 1070.2% to $4.1 billion in 2025.
